news 2026/6/8 23:08:19

HY-MT1.5-1.8B模型优化:INT8量化实战指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
HY-MT1.5-1.8B模型优化:INT8量化实战指南

HY-MT1.5-1.8B模型优化:INT8量化实战指南


1. 引言

随着多语言交流需求的不断增长,高质量、低延迟的翻译模型成为智能硬件和边缘计算场景中的关键组件。腾讯开源的混元翻译大模型HY-MT1.5系列,凭借其在多语言互译、混合语言处理和术语控制等方面的卓越表现,迅速成为行业关注焦点。

其中,HY-MT1.5-1.8B模型以仅18亿参数实现了接近70亿参数模型(HY-MT1.5-7B)的翻译质量,同时具备更低的推理延迟与显存占用,特别适合部署于资源受限的边缘设备。然而,在实际落地过程中,如何进一步压缩模型体积、提升推理效率,仍是工程化部署的核心挑战。

本文聚焦HY-MT1.5-1.8B 模型的 INT8 量化实战,系统性地介绍从模型加载、量化策略选择、实现步骤到性能对比的完整流程,帮助开发者在保证翻译质量的前提下,显著降低部署成本,实现高效实时翻译。


2. 模型背景与技术定位

2.1 HY-MT1.5 系列模型概览

混元翻译模型 1.5 版本包含两个核心模型:

  • HY-MT1.5-1.8B:18亿参数的轻量级翻译模型
  • HY-MT1.5-7B:70亿参数的高性能翻译模型

两者均支持33 种主流语言之间的互译,并融合了包括藏语、维吾尔语在内的5 种民族语言及方言变体,覆盖更广泛的本地化需求。

值得一提的是,HY-MT1.5-7B 是基于 WMT25 夺冠模型升级而来,在解释性翻译、代码注释翻译、中英混合文本等复杂场景下表现出色。而HY-MT1.5-1.8B 虽然参数量仅为前者的约 26%,但在多个基准测试中达到了与其相当的 BLEU 分数,展现出极高的“性价比”。

模型参数量显存占用(FP16)推理速度(A100)部署场景
HY-MT1.5-1.8B1.8B~3.6GB45 tokens/s边缘设备、移动端
HY-MT1.5-7B7.0B~14GB18 tokens/s云端服务

💡为何选择 1.8B?
在多数实际应用中,并非所有任务都需要极致翻译质量。HY-MT1.5-1.8B 在精度损失 <0.5 BLEU 的前提下,将推理速度提升 2.5 倍以上,是边缘侧部署的理想选择。


2.2 核心功能特性

HY-MT1.5 系列模型不仅在规模上形成互补,在功能层面也引入多项创新机制:

  • 术语干预(Term Intervention):允许用户指定专业术语的翻译结果,适用于医疗、法律、金融等垂直领域。
  • 上下文翻译(Context-Aware Translation):利用前后句信息提升代词指代、省略补全等长依赖任务的表现。
  • 格式化翻译(Preserve Formatting):自动保留原文中的 HTML 标签、Markdown 结构、代码块等非文本内容。

这些功能使得模型不仅能“翻得准”,还能“用得好”,极大增强了在企业级应用中的可用性。


3. INT8量化方案设计与实现

3.1 为什么需要INT8量化?

尽管 HY-MT1.5-1.8B 已属轻量模型,但其 FP16 版本仍需约 3.6GB 显存,对于消费级 GPU(如 RTX 3060/4090D)或嵌入式设备而言仍存在压力。通过INT8 量化,可将权重从 16 位浮点压缩至 8 位整型,带来以下优势:

  • ✅ 显存占用减少~50%
  • ✅ 推理吞吐提升30%-50%
  • ✅ 支持更低功耗设备部署(如 Jetson Orin)
  • ✅ 兼容 TensorRT、ONNX Runtime 等主流推理引擎

更重要的是,现代量化技术(如 AWQ、GPTQ、SmoothQuant)已能有效缓解精度损失问题,使 INT8 模型在翻译任务中保持高保真输出。


3.2 量化策略选型对比

我们评估了三种主流静态量化方法在 HY-MT1.5-1.8B 上的表现:

方法是否需校准集精度损失(BLEU↓)推理加速比易用性
PyTorch Native PTQ-0.61.3x⭐⭐⭐⭐
GPTQ (4-bit)-0.91.8x⭐⭐
SmoothQuant-0.41.5x⭐⭐⭐

最终选择PyTorch 原生动态量化(Dynamic Quantization) + 手动校准的静态量化增强方案,兼顾精度与部署便捷性。

🔍为何不直接用 GPTQ?
尽管 GPTQ 可实现 4-bit 压缩,但其对注意力层的支持尚不稳定,且在中文-英文混合翻译任务中出现术语错译现象。因此,我们优先保障翻译一致性。


3.3 实现步骤详解

以下是基于 Hugging Face Transformers 和 PyTorch 的完整 INT8 量化实现流程。

步骤 1:环境准备
pip install transformers torch accelerate sentencepiece onnx onnxruntime-gpu

确保使用 CUDA 11.8+ 和 PyTorch 2.0+ 环境。

步骤 2:加载原始模型
from transformers import AutoTokenizer, AutoModelForSeq2SeqLM model_name = "Tencent/HY-MT1.5-1.8B" tokenizer = AutoTokenizer.from_pretrained(model_name) model = AutoModelForSeq2SeqLM.from_pretrained( model_name, torch_dtype="auto", device_map="auto" # 自动分配到 GPU )
步骤 3:配置动态量化
import torch.quantization # 准备量化配置 model.qconfig = torch.quantization.default_qconfig # 对线性层进行动态量化(仅权重) quantized_model = torch.quantization.quantize_dynamic( model, {torch.nn.Linear}, # 量化目标:所有线性层 dtype=torch.qint8 # 目标数据类型 ) print("✅ 模型已完成 INT8 动态量化")
步骤 4:添加校准机制(提升精度)

使用少量真实翻译样本进行激活值统计,优化量化参数:

def calibrate(model, tokenizer, calibration_texts): model.eval() with torch.no_grad(): for text in calibration_texts[:32]: # 使用32条样本校准 inputs = tokenizer(text, return_tensors="pt", truncation=True, max_length=512).to("cuda") model(**inputs) # 示例校准数据 calibration_data = [ "欢迎来到深圳,这里是中国科技创新中心。", "The quick brown fox jumps over the lazy dog.", "混合语言场景:This is a test句子包含English和中文。" ] calibrate(quantized_model, tokenizer, calibration_data)
步骤 5:保存量化模型
quantized_model.save_pretrained("./hy-mt1.5-1.8b-int8") tokenizer.save_pretrained("./hy-mt1.5-1.8b-int8") print("💾 量化模型已保存至本地目录")

3.4 性能测试与效果验证

我们在单张 RTX 4090D 上对原始 FP16 与 INT8 模型进行了对比测试:

指标FP16 模型INT8 量化模型提升幅度
显存占用3.6 GB1.9 GB↓ 47%
推理延迟(batch=1)128 ms89 ms↓ 30%
吞吐量(tokens/s)4258↑ 38%
BLEU 得分(WMT-ZH-EN)32.131.6↓ 0.5

结论:INT8 量化后,模型在几乎无感知精度损失的情况下,实现了显著的性能提升,完全满足实时翻译场景需求。


4. 部署实践与优化建议

4.1 快速部署路径

根据官方文档,推荐以下三步完成部署:

  1. 部署镜像:在支持 CUDA 的机器上拉取预置镜像(如 CSDN 星图平台提供的一键镜像)bash docker run -d --gpus all -p 8080:8080 csdn/hy-mt1.5-1.8b-int8

  2. 等待自动启动:容器内会自动加载量化模型并启动 API 服务

  3. 访问网页推理界面:通过浏览器打开http://localhost:8080进入交互式翻译页面

该方式适用于快速验证和原型开发。


4.2 生产级优化建议

为确保长期稳定运行,提出以下三条最佳实践:

  1. 启用 KV Cache 重用
    在连续对话或多段落翻译中,缓存解码器的 Key/Value 状态,避免重复计算,可进一步降低延迟 20% 以上。

  2. 结合 ONNX Runtime 加速
    将量化后的模型导出为 ONNX 格式,利用 ORT 的 Graph Optimization 和 CUDA Execution Provider 实现更高吞吐:

```python from transformers.onnx import convert_export_menu

convert_export_menu(model=quantized_model, output="onnx/", format="onnx") ```

  1. 按需启用术语干预模块
    构建术语词典(Terminology Bank),在特定业务流中动态注入,例如:json {"company": "腾讯", "product": "混元"}可通过 API 参数forced_terms控制是否启用。

5. 总结

5. 总结

本文围绕腾讯开源的轻量级翻译大模型HY-MT1.5-1.8B,系统阐述了其在边缘部署场景下的INT8 量化实战路径。通过动态量化与校准机制的结合,成功将模型显存占用降低近一半,推理速度提升 38%,同时保持 BLEU 指标仅下降 0.5,充分验证了其在实时翻译任务中的可行性与优越性。

核心收获总结如下:

  1. HY-MT1.5-1.8B 是当前少有的兼具高性能与低延迟的开源翻译模型,尤其适合多语言混合、民族语言支持等中国特色场景。
  2. INT8 量化是推动大模型走向终端的关键一步,合理使用 PyTorch 原生工具即可实现高效压缩。
  3. 量化不是终点,而是起点——后续可通过 ONNX 加速、KV 缓存、术语干预等手段持续优化用户体验。

未来,随着量化算法与硬件协同优化的深入,我们有望看到更多类似 HY-MT1.5 系列的大模型“瘦身”后走进手机、耳机、翻译笔等 everyday AI 设备中,真正实现“人人可用的智能翻译”。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/30 13:33:15

Qwen3-VL多租户隔离:1张A100安全共享,成本均摊更划算

Qwen3-VL多租户隔离&#xff1a;1张A100安全共享&#xff0c;成本均摊更划算 1. 为什么需要多租户隔离&#xff1f; 想象一下孵化器里有5家初创公司&#xff0c;每家都需要AI能力来处理图像和文本任务。如果每家公司单独采购一张A100显卡&#xff0c;不仅成本高昂&#xff08…

作者头像 李华
网站建设 2026/6/6 3:41:03

HY-MT1.5-7B如何应对混合语言?真实场景翻译部署测试

HY-MT1.5-7B如何应对混合语言&#xff1f;真实场景翻译部署测试 1. 背景与问题提出 随着全球化进程加速&#xff0c;跨语言交流日益频繁&#xff0c;传统翻译模型在面对混合语言输入&#xff08;如中英夹杂、方言与标准语混用&#xff09;时常常表现不佳。用户在社交媒体、客…

作者头像 李华
网站建设 2026/6/6 11:40:18

基于springboot的山西高校毕业生信息咨询平台_w2i00tg5

文章目录摘要主要技术与实现手段系统设计与实现的思路系统设计方法java类核心代码部分展示结论源码lw获取/同行可拿货,招校园代理 &#xff1a;文章底部获取博主联系方式&#xff01;摘要 山西高校毕业生信息咨询平台基于SpringBoot框架开发&#xff0c;旨在为省内高校学生、用…

作者头像 李华
网站建设 2026/6/4 15:21:51

开源翻译模型新选择:HY-MT1.5全面评测报告

开源翻译模型新选择&#xff1a;HY-MT1.5全面评测报告 随着多语言交流需求的不断增长&#xff0c;高质量、低延迟的机器翻译模型成为AI应用落地的关键组件。传统商业翻译API虽具备一定性能优势&#xff0c;但在数据隐私、定制化能力和部署灵活性方面存在局限。在此背景下&…

作者头像 李华
网站建设 2026/6/6 2:19:44

Qwen3-VL显存优化方案:INT4量化实测,20G显存就能跑

Qwen3-VL显存优化方案&#xff1a;INT4量化实测&#xff0c;20G显存就能跑 1. 为什么我们需要量化&#xff1f; 作为一位拥有2080Ti显卡&#xff08;11G显存&#xff09;的个人开发者&#xff0c;你可能已经发现原版Qwen3-VL模型根本无法加载。这就像试图把一头大象塞进小轿车…

作者头像 李华
网站建设 2026/6/3 13:06:29

HY-MT1.5质量评估:BLEU与人工评分

HY-MT1.5质量评估&#xff1a;BLEU与人工评分 1. 引言 随着全球化进程的加速&#xff0c;高质量机器翻译技术成为跨语言沟通的核心基础设施。腾讯近期开源了其混元大模型系列中的翻译专用版本——HY-MT1.5&#xff0c;包含两个参数量级的模型&#xff1a;HY-MT1.5-1.8B 和 HY…

作者头像 李华